【javaee是啥】Java EE(Java Platform, Enterprise Edition)是Java平台的一个重要分支,主要用于开发和部署企业级应用程序。它在传统的Java SE(标准版)基础上增加了许多用于构建大型、分布式、多层架构应用的功能模块。Java EE不仅简化了企业应用的开发流程,还提供了标准化的接口和框架,使得开发者可以更高效地构建可扩展、可维护的企业级系统。
以下是对Java EE的总结和关键内容的表格展示:
项目 | 内容 |
全称 | Java Platform, Enterprise Edition |
简介 | Java EE 是 Java 的企业级版本,提供一套用于开发和部署企业级应用的标准 API 和框架。 |
主要用途 | 适用于需要高并发、高可用性、分布式计算的企业级应用开发。 |
核心技术 | 包括 JSP、Servlet、JPA、EJB、JMS、JNDI、JTA 等。 |
与 Java SE 的区别 | Java SE 是标准版,适合桌面应用和小型系统;Java EE 则面向企业级应用,提供更多服务支持。 |
开发模式 | 支持多层架构(如表现层、业务逻辑层、数据访问层),便于模块化开发。 |
框架支持 | 可以与 Spring、Hibernate、Struts 等主流框架结合使用,提升开发效率。 |
优势 | 标准化、可移植性强、易于维护、支持分布式系统。 |
缺点 | 学习曲线较陡,配置复杂,部分功能已被现代框架替代。 |
当前状态 | Java EE 已被 Oracle 移交给 Eclipse 基金会,并更名为 Jakarta EE。 |
总的来说,Java EE 是 Java 生态中不可或缺的一部分,尤其在企业级应用开发中扮演着重要角色。虽然随着现代化框架的兴起,Java EE 的使用有所减少,但其核心理念和一些关键技术仍然广泛应用于实际开发中。